SC.Phonebook Recovery simplifies recovering contacts for subscribers who lose their phone or change phone numbers, but remain in the same mobile operator network.
How to recover — from the subscriber's number, send an SMS message with the request to call back or report a phone number. A contact list can be retrieved in the ways below:
- From SyncML server, if the subscriber uses synchronization
- From billing system — using subscriber's activity (SMS, MMS, voice calls)
Also this service can be useful:
- For those not using synchronization
- For those whose phone is not capable of correct synchronization
- For those who have not paid for synchronization (but their contacts and events are already stored on the server)
- When synchronization service is not available in the operator's network
- For sending your phone number to your contacts
Connection configuration in the operator's network
- HTTP interface or another integration with billing system
- SyncML server integration (optional)
- Integration to monitoring system by SNMP
- SMPP-connection to SMSC
- Interface for the platform administrator
- Provides API for integration with operator's systems (ex. Enable service from subscriber's web interface account)
